:root{--primary-dark:#2a499e;--secondary-dark:#980200;--bs-black:#000;--bs-white:#fff;--gray-100:#f5f5f5;--gray-200:#e9ecef;--gray-300:#ddd;--gray-400:#c4c4c4;--gray-500:#adb5bd;--gray-600:#707070;--gray-650:#7b7b7b;--gray-700:#434343;--gray-800:#2e2e2e;--gray-900:#242424;--gray-950:#0b0b0b;--bs-primary:#2f68ff;--bs-secondary:#de4533;--bs-dark:var(--bs-black);--yellow:#fefa00;--yellow-dark:#fee100;--green:#4ec618;--green-dark:#33a500;--blue-02:#1c3476;--bs-body-bg:var(--bs-white);--bs-body-color:var(--bs-black);--bs-body-font-size:1.6rem;--bs-body-line-height:1.375;--bs-body-font-family:Source Sans Pro, Arial, Helvetica, sans-serif;--bs-link-color:var(--bs-secondary);--bs-link-hover-color:var(--secondary-dark);--bs-text-muted:#7b7b7b;--bs-font-weight-bold:600;--font-weight-bold:600;--bs-font-family-base:Source Sans Pro, Arial, Helvetica, sans-serif;--font-family-secondary:Open Sans, Arial, Helvetica, sans-serif;--h1-font-size:4.6rem;--h2-font-size:3rem;--h3-font-size:3.6rem;--h4-font-size:2rem;--h5-font-size:2.2rem;--h6-font-size:1.7rem;--h1-font-size-sm:3.6rem;--h2-font-size-sm:2.6rem;--h3-font-size-sm:var(--h3-font-size);--h4-font-size-sm:var(--h4-font-size);--h5-font-size-sm:var(--h5-font-size);--h6-font-size-sm:var(--h6-font-size);--headings-font-weight:700;--headings-font-family:Open Sans, Arial, Helvetica, sans-serif;--btn-font-size:1.7rem;--btn-line-height:1.412;--btn-font-weight:700;--btn-padding-y:0.8rem;--btn-padding-x:1.6rem;--btn-font-size-sm:1rem;--btn-padding-y-sm:0.4rem;--btn-padding-x-sm:0.6rem;--btn-font-size-lg:1.6rem;--btn-padding-y-lg:1.1rem;--btn-padding-x-lg:1rem;--input-border-color:#7b7b7b;--input-color:#7b7b7b;--input-placeholder-color:#7b7b7b;--input-bg:var(--bs-white);--input-box-shadow:none;--input-height:4rem;--input-font-size:1.6rem;--input-font-weight:400;--input-padding-y:0.4rem;--input-padding-x:1.4rem;--input-focus-bg:var(--bs-white);--input-border-color-focus:#0b0b0b;--input-color-focus:#0b0b0b;--bs-breadcrumb-margin-bottom:0.8rem;--header-bg-color:var(--bs-white);--header-color:var(--bs-black);--header-drop-bg-color:var(--bs-white);--header-drop-bg-color-mobile:var(--gray-100);--header-drop-color:var(--gray-950);--header-drop-color-mobile:var(--gray-950);--header-drop-hover-color:var(--primary-dark);--extra-menu-bg-color:var(--bs-white);--extra-menu-color:var(--bs-black);--menu-bg-color-mobile:var(--bs-white);--menu-color-mobile:var(--bs-black);--footer-bg-color:var(--gray-800);--footer-color:var(--bs-white);--footer-secondary-bg-color:var(--bs-black);--footer-secondary-color:var(--gray-650);--backdrop-bg:var(--bs-black);--backdrop-opacity:0.4;--modal-border-width:0;--modal-border-color:var(--bs-white);--modal-bg:var(--bs-white);--gray-light:#7b7b7b;--gray-002:#212121;--bs-gutter-x:3rem}.car-item{position:relative;padding:0 2rem;margin-bottom:3.7rem;background:var(--bs-white);border:.1rem solid var(--gray-400);-webkit-box-shadow:0 .3rem .6rem 0 rgb(0 0 0 / .16);box-shadow:0 .3rem .6rem 0 rgb(0 0 0 / .16);color:rgb(122.9905,122.9905,122.9905);width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-transition:all 0.3s ease;transition:all 0.3s ease;-webkit-transition-property:-webkit-box-shadow;transition-property:-webkit-box-shadow;transition-property:box-shadow;transition-property:box-shadow,-webkit-box-shadow;font-family:var(--headings-font-family)}.car-item:hover{-webkit-box-shadow:0 .3rem .6rem 0 rgb(0 0 0 / .5);box-shadow:0 .3rem .6rem 0 rgb(0 0 0 / .5)}.car-item .car-image{margin-top:-.1rem;margin-left:-2.1rem;margin-right:-2.1rem;margin-bottom:2.1rem}@media (min-width:992px){.car-item .car-image{margin-bottom:2.2rem}}.car-item .car-image .img-link{position:relative;overflow:hidden;display:block;aspect-ratio:330/220}.car-item .car-image .img-link img{position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.car-item .car-image a.btn-cart{padding-bottom:inherit}.car-item .car-image .condition{position:absolute;left:-.1rem;top:0;margin-top:66.667%;-webkit-transform:translateY(-100%);transform:translateY(-100%);max-width:100%;padding:.8rem .9rem .7rem;font-weight:400;font-size:1.6rem;line-height:1.25;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;background-color:var(--gray-600);color:var(--bs-white)}.car-item .car-image .condition.vorfuhrmodell,.car-item .car-image .condition.jahreswagen{background-color:var(--gray-800);color:var(--bs-white)}.car-item .car-image .condition.neues-fahrzeug{background-color:var(--primary-dark);color:var(--bs-white)}.car-item .car-image .condition.vorlauffahrzeug{background-color:var();color:var(--bs-white)}.car-item .car-image .condition.occasion{background-color:var(--bs-secondary);color:var(--bs-white)}.car-item .car-image .condition.elektro{background-color:var(--green);color:var(--bs-white)}.car-item .car-image .condition br{display:none!important}.car-item .favorite,.car-item .btn-cart{position:absolute;top:-.1rem;right:-.1rem;bottom:auto;z-index:5;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:4rem;height:4rem;font-size:1.8rem;line-height:1}.car-item .favorite{margin-right:4.4rem}.car-item .favorite .fa-star-o{font-weight:900}.car-item .favorite .fa-star-o::before{content:"\f005"}.car-item h4,.car-item .h4{color:var(--bs-body-color);text-transform:uppercase;font-weight:var(--bs-font-weight-bold);font-family:var(--bs-font-family-base);font-size:2rem;line-height:1.1;margin-bottom:1.7rem}@media (min-width:992px){.car-item h4,.car-item .h4{margin-bottom:1.5rem}}.car-item h4 a,.car-item .h4 a{color:inherit}.car-item h4 a:hover,.car-item .h4 a:hover{color:var(--bs-secondary)}.car-item p{color:var(--bs-body-color);margin-bottom:1.8rem}.car-item .list-inline{margin-top:auto;margin-left:-.5rem;margin-bottom:1rem;-webkit-columns:2;-moz-columns:2;columns:2;-webkit-column-gap:1rem;-moz-column-gap:1rem;column-gap:1rem}@media (max-width:991.98px){.car-item .list-inline{margin-right:-1rem}}@media (min-width:992px){.car-item .list-inline{padding-right:1.5rem}}.car-item .list-inline>li{padding-left:.5rem}.car-item .price{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-top:1rem;margin-left:-2rem;margin-right:-2rem;padding:1rem 2rem;border-top:.1rem solid #f2f2f2;font-weight:400;font-size:2rem;line-height:1.1}.car-item .price>*{-webkit-box-flex:0;-ms-flex-positive:0;flex-grow:0}@media (min-width:992px){.car-item .price>*{max-width:50%}}.car-item .price .description{display:none}.car-item .price .old-price{text-decoration:none;position:relative;-webkit-box-flex:0;-ms-flex-positive:0;flex-grow:0;-ms-flex-preferred-size:auto;flex-basis:auto;min-width:.1rem;margin-right:.5rem}.car-item .price .old-price::before{position:absolute;top:0;left:0;right:0;bottom:0;content:"";margin-top:auto;margin-bottom:auto;height:.2rem;background:var(--bs-secondary);-webkit-transform:rotate(-8deg);transform:rotate(-8deg)}.car-item .price .new-price{font-weight:var(--bs-font-weight-bold);font-size:1.1em;line-height:1;color:var(--bs-body-color)}@media (min-width:992px){.car-item .price .new-price{-ms-flex-preferred-size:50%;flex-basis:50%}}.car-item .month-price{-webkit-box-ordinal-group:11;-ms-flex-order:10;order:10;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-top:3px;margin-left:-2rem;margin-right:-2rem;padding:.5rem 5.5rem .5rem 2rem;min-height:4.7rem;font-weight:var(--bs-font-weight-bold);font-size:1.6rem;line-height:1.375;color:var(--bs-body-color);border-top:1px solid #f2f2f2}.car-item .car-list{padding-right:14.6rem;margin-top:auto;min-height:19.7rem}@media (min-width:992px){.car-item .car-list{min-height:20rem}}.car-item .car-list .list-inline{display:block;-webkit-columns:unset;-moz-columns:unset;columns:unset;line-height:1.3125}.car-item .car-list .list-inline li{border-bottom:1px solid var(--bs-gray-300);padding-block:.4rem}.car-item .car-content{position:absolute;right:0;bottom:0;width:12.5r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;row-gap:.4rem;text-align:center}@media (min-width:1280px){.car-item .car-content{width:15.9rem}}.car-item .car-content .discount{padding:.6rem .5rem 1rem;background-image:-webkit-gradient(linear,left top,right top,from(var(--bs-secondary)),to(var(--secondary-dark)));background-image:linear-gradient(to right,var(--bs-secondary) 0%,var(--secondary-dark) 100%);color:var(--bs-white);font-size:1.4rem;line-height:1}.car-item .car-content .discount-value{display:block;font-weight:700;font-size:3rem;line-height:1}.car-item .car-content .discount-name{display:block}.car-item .car-content .leasing{background-image:-webkit-gradient(linear,left top,right top,from(var(--primary-dark)),color-stop(50%,var(--bs-primary)),to(var(--primary-dark)));background-image:linear-gradient(to right,var(--primary-dark),var(--bs-primary) 50%,var(--primary-dark));background-size:200% 100%;color:var(--bs-white);font-size:1.4rem;line-height:1;padding:1.2rem .5rem}.car-item .car-content .leasing .description{display:block}.car-item .car-content .leasing-price{display:block;font-weight:700;font-size:2.2rem;line-height:1}.car-item .car-content .leasing:hover{background-position:-100% 0}.car-item .car-content .price{background:var(--gray-800);color:var(--bs-white);display:block;margin:0;border:0;font-size:1.4rem;text-align:inherit;padding:1rem .5rem 1.4rem}.car-item .car-content .price .description{display:block;font-size:1.6rem;line-height:1.25;max-width:none}.car-item .car-content .price .old-price{display:none}.car-item .car-content .price .new-price{display:block;font-weight:700;font-size:2.2rem;line-height:1;color:inherit;width:auto;max-width:none}.car-grid:not([data-view=list]) p{display:none}.car-grid[data-view=grid]>*{display:-webkit-box;display:-ms-flexbox;display:flex}.car-grid[data-view=grid] .car-item h4 .list-title,.car-grid[data-view=grid] .car-item .h4 .list-title{display:none}@media (min-width:768px){.car-grid[data-view=list]>*{-ms-flex-preferred-size:100%;flex-basis:100%;min-width:100%;max-width:100%}.car-grid[data-view=list] .car-item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;padding-top:2rem;padding-left:28rem;padding-right:14.4rem;padding-bottom:2.2rem;min-height:25.9rem}}@media (min-width:768px) and (min-width:1280px){.car-grid[data-view=list] .car-item{padding-right:19.4rem}}@media (min-width:768px) and (min-width:1440px){.car-grid[data-view=list] .car-item{padding-top:2.9rem;padding-left:42.6rem}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-image{position:absolute;top:0;left:0;bottom:0;width:26rem;margin-left:-.1rem;margin-right:0;margin-bottom:-.1rem}}@media (min-width:768px) and (min-width:1440px){.car-grid[data-view=list] .car-item .car-image{width:38.6rem}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-image .img-link{position:absolute;top:0;left:0;right:0;bottom:0;padding-bottom:0;aspect-ratio:unset}}@media (min-width:768px) and (min-width:768px){.car-grid[data-view=list] .car-item .car-image .img-link{right:auto;width:26rem}}@media (min-width:768px) and (min-width:1440px){.car-grid[data-view=list] .car-item .car-image .img-link{width:38.6rem}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-image .condition{top:auto;bottom:0;-webkit-transform:none;transform:none}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-image .favorite,.car-grid[data-view=list] .car-item .car-image .btn-cart{right:0}.car-grid[data-view=list] .car-item .favorite{bottom:0;right:0}.car-grid[data-view=list] .car-item h4,.car-grid[data-view=list] .car-item .h4{margin-bottom:1.7rem}}@media (min-width:768px) and (min-width:992px){.car-grid[data-view=list] .car-item .list-inline{width:50%;padding-right:0}}@media (min-width:768px){.car-grid[data-view=list] .car-item>.price{position:absolute;left:26rem;right:calc(50% - 13rem);bottom:0;height:4.8rem;margin-left:0;margin-right:-1rem;padding-left:2rem;background:var(--gray-100)}}@media (min-width:768px) and (min-width:768px) and (max-width:1439.98px){.car-grid[data-view=list] .car-item>.price{padding-right:1rem;font-size:1.6rem}}@media (min-width:768px) and (min-width:1440px){.car-grid[data-view=list] .car-item>.price{left:38.6rem;right:calc(50% - 19.3rem);padding-left:4rem}}@media (min-width:768px){.car-grid[data-view=list] .car-item .month-price{position:absolute;left:calc(26rem + 50% - 13rem);right:4.8rem;bottom:0;height:4.8rem;margin-left:1rem;margin-right:0;padding-left:1rem;padding-right:1rem}}@media (min-width:768px) and (min-width:1440px){.car-grid[data-view=list] .car-item .month-price{left:calc(38.6rem + 50% - 19.3rem);padding-left:3rem}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-content .price{position:static}.car-grid[data-view=list] .car-item .car-list{margin-top:auto;min-height:1px;padding-right:0}.car-grid[data-view=list] .car-item .car-list .list-inline{-webkit-columns:2;-moz-columns:2;columns:2;width:auto;margin:0;gap:1rem}}@media (min-width:768px) and (min-width:992px){.car-grid[data-view=list] .car-item .car-list .list-inline{-webkit-columns:3;-moz-columns:3;columns:3}}@media (min-width:768px){.car-grid[data-view=list] .car-item .car-list .list-inline li{border-bottom:0;padding-left:0}}.car-grid[data-view=list] .car-item h4 .grid-title,.car-grid[data-view=list] .car-item .h4 .grid-title{display:none}